415 Marine Parade is a boutique bed and breakfast with five luxury suites and a communal dining room.

news image

The villa, which dates back to 1860, is run by Esther and Tom Seymour who been involved in luxury tourism for more than 20 years - and it shows. The building was right on the beach in its earlier years, until the 1931 earthquake uplifted the waterfront.

get quote or book now in New Zealand

The historical building has been recently refurbished, in keeping with its classic heritage.

We stayed in the Portland Suite, which has French doors leading to a balcony with panoramic views, from Waikawa/Portland Island in the north right down to Cape Kidnappers in the south.

The suite has a plush king bed, espresso machine, and lots of space to unwind - each room also has access to electric or pedal bikes for hire.

A central theme of the villa is an opportunity to socialise: every second evening there's a complimentary happy hour with finger food. The communal dining room has snacks and cake, where you can join your fellow guests to swap stories after a day exploring.

Breakfast is delicious; with buffet and cafe-style options and fresh coffee.

However, the region is far more than a funky city; its vineyards blanket the land in every direction – and from these fertile rolling valleys come much of the country's red wine. There are more than 70 wineries and 30 cellar door experiences to explore.

After visiting the infamous the region's best lookout, stop on the way back at the Big Redwoods Forest. Here you'll find an enchanting collection of 223 Californian Redwoods, the tallest tree species in the world. It'll soak up a peaceful hour walking among the giants.
